Vine weevil larvae feed on plant roots beneath the soil surface, causing sudden plant collapse and serious damage to ornamental plants and fruit crops. Treating the soil with beneficial nematodes targets the pest at its most destructive stage. Effective Biological Vine Weevil Control This product contains Heterorhabditis bacteriophora, a species of beneficial nematode widely used in natural pest control. Once introduced into moist soil, the nematodes actively seek out vine weevil larvae feeding around plant roots. After entering the larvae, they multiply and spread through the soil, helping reduce the pest population across the treatment area. Ideal for Large Gardens This large coverage pack is suitable for: Garden borders Raised beds Ornamental planting schemes Strawberry beds Large container collections It provides coverage for up to 100 m², making it ideal for larger gardens or multiple treatment areas. Best Treatment Times Apply when vine weevil larvae are active in soil: Spring (MarchâMay) Late summer to autumn (AugustâOctober) Nematodes require soil temperatures above 8°C and moist soil conditions. Note: These are a live product and have an expiry date of around 2 weeks. Easy Application Simply mix the nematodes with water and apply around plant roots using a watering can or applicator. Maintain moist soil conditions for several days after application to help the nematodes move through the soil.
